移动应用技术目前面临的难题

时间: 2023-03-23 15:03:24 浏览: 60
移动应用技术目前面临的难题包括但不限于以下几点: 1.多设备适配问题:不同品牌、不同型号的设备在硬件配置、屏幕尺寸等方面存在差异,因此需要在开发应用时考虑不同设备的适配问题,以确保应用在各种设备上能够正常运行。 2.性能优化问题:移动设备的硬件性能相对于台式机和笔记本电脑要弱一些,因此需要对应用进行性能优化,以确保应用能够在资源受限的环境下运行流畅。 3.安全性问题:移动设备在安全方面存在一些特殊的问题,如用户隐私、数据泄漏等,因此开发者需要在应用开发的过程中加强对安全性的考虑和保护,以确保应用的安全性。 4.系统版本兼容问题:由于移动设备的操作系统版本更新较快,应用需要适配多个操作系统版本,以确保应用在不同版本的系统上都能够正常运行。 5.用户体验问题:移动应用用户数量众多,用户对应用的体验有着更高的要求。因此,应用的界面设计、交互方式等需要考虑用户体验,以提高应用的吸引力和使用率。
相关问题

移动应用开发技术发展趋势

根据引用内容,移动应用开发技术的发展趋势包括以下几个方面: 1. 创新解决方案:移动应用开发领域不断提出创新的、具有前瞻性的解决方案,以解决日常问题和改善用户体验。 2. 迭代改进:设计师、创作者和开发人员持续迭代和改进已建立的想法,以提高移动用户的用户体验。 3. 人工智能和机器学习:移动应用开发人员利用人工智能和机器学习等技术,提供更智能、自动化和个性化的移动应用程序和解决方案。 4. 云计算集成:移动应用开发人员利用云计算技术,实现数据存储、处理和分析的高效和可扩展,提供更强大的功能和体验。 5. 增强现实:增强现实技术与移动应用的结合,创造出引人入胜的虚拟现实体验,扩展了移动应用的功能和可能性。 6. 区块链技术:移动应用开发人员开始利用区块链技术,确保数据的安全和可信度,为用户提供更可靠的移动应用解决方案。 7. 语音识别:移动应用开发人员将语音识别技术应用于移动应用中,使用户能够通过语音来与应用程序进行交互和控制。

移动应用开发技术现状

移动应用开发技术现状经历了许多令人兴奋和充满希望的进展。其中包括以下几个方面的技术演进: 1. 移动端跨平台技术:随着不同操作系统和设备的增多,移动应用程序开发者越来越需要一种跨平台的开发方式。跨平台技术,如React Native和Flutter,使开发者能够在多个平台上使用相同的代码库构建应用程序,提高了开发效率和代码的可重用性。 2. 人工智能和机器学习:人工智能和机器学习技术在移动应用程序开发中发挥着越来越重要的作用。开发者可以利用这些技术来实现自然语言处理、图像识别、推荐系统等功能,提升用户体验并提供个性化的内容和服务。 3. 云服务和后端即服务(BaaS):云服务和BaaS平台使开发者能够将应用程序的后端基础设施外包给第三方服务提供商,从而降低了开发和维护成本。这些平台提供了各种功能,如数据存储、用户认证、推送通知等,使开发者能够更专注于应用程序的前端开发。 4. 增强现实和虚拟现实:增强现实和虚拟现实技术已经成为移动应用开发的热点领域。开发者可以利用AR和VR技术来创建沉浸式和交互式的应用程序,为用户提供全新的体验和功能。

相关推荐

最新推荐

recommend-type

中南大学移动应用开发实验报告一

一、实验目的 1. 掌握Android中的MVC设计模式 ... 1、参照参考书《Android编程权威指南: the big nerd ranch guide》第2、3、4、5章给出的Android应用GeoQuiz进阶的详细代码和讲解,完善GeoQuiz应用,使得 ……
recommend-type

移动应用OWASP-Top-10

移动应用 Mobile-OWASP-Top10 中文版,需要学习移动安全,但是英文不太好的可以参考
recommend-type

移动应用开发-大作业-项目总结.doc

Vue_Demo_音乐_电影评论详细报告,是一次Vue大作业时候写的报告,包括设计、需求分析、功能介绍等。
recommend-type

移动应用开发( Java web )课程设计

本系统主要实现了高校教师对学生信息的录入、删除、查询及修改。整个系统分为学生个人信息管理以及学生成绩管理两大模块。其中,学生个人信息管理模块包括学生姓名的录入和修改、学生学号的录入和修改、学生信息的...
recommend-type

PhoneGap移动应用开发框架预研

对移动应用跨平台框架PhoneGap做了基本信息、跨平台原理、plug-ins原理、编译发布、适用场景、优劣势等的分析
recommend-type

zigbee-cluster-library-specification

最新的zigbee-cluster-library-specification说明文档。
recommend-type

管理建模和仿真的文件

管理Boualem Benatallah引用此版本:布阿利姆·贝纳塔拉。管理建模和仿真。约瑟夫-傅立叶大学-格勒诺布尔第一大学,1996年。法语。NNT:电话:00345357HAL ID:电话:00345357https://theses.hal.science/tel-003453572008年12月9日提交HAL是一个多学科的开放存取档案馆,用于存放和传播科学研究论文,无论它们是否被公开。论文可以来自法国或国外的教学和研究机构,也可以来自公共或私人研究中心。L’archive ouverte pluridisciplinaire
recommend-type

【实战演练】MATLAB用遗传算法改进粒子群GA-PSO算法

![MATLAB智能算法合集](https://static.fuxi.netease.com/fuxi-official/web/20221101/83f465753fd49c41536a5640367d4340.jpg) # 2.1 遗传算法的原理和实现 遗传算法(GA)是一种受生物进化过程启发的优化算法。它通过模拟自然选择和遗传机制来搜索最优解。 **2.1.1 遗传算法的编码和解码** 编码是将问题空间中的解表示为二进制字符串或其他数据结构的过程。解码是将编码的解转换为问题空间中的实际解的过程。常见的编码方法包括二进制编码、实数编码和树形编码。 **2.1.2 遗传算法的交叉和
recommend-type

openstack的20种接口有哪些

以下是OpenStack的20种API接口: 1. Identity (Keystone) API 2. Compute (Nova) API 3. Networking (Neutron) API 4. Block Storage (Cinder) API 5. Object Storage (Swift) API 6. Image (Glance) API 7. Telemetry (Ceilometer) API 8. Orchestration (Heat) API 9. Database (Trove) API 10. Bare Metal (Ironic) API 11. DNS
recommend-type

JSBSim Reference Manual

JSBSim参考手册,其中包含JSBSim简介,JSBSim配置文件xml的编写语法,编程手册以及一些应用实例等。其中有部分内容还没有写完,估计有生之年很难看到完整版了,但是内容还是很有参考价值的。